Butler Demographics

Population

  • Total Population13,452
  • Male Population(51.4 %) 6,910
  • Female Population(48.6 %) 6,542
  • Median Age39.40
There are currently 13,452 people living in Butler. Out of the total population number, 6,910 are men and 6,542 are women. The median age for Butler dwellers is 39.40.

Households

  • Total Households6,036
  • Family Households2,920
  • Non-family Households3,116
  • Households With Children1,448
  • Households Without Children4,588
  • Average People Per Household2.15
There are currently 6,036 households in Butler. Out of this total, 2,920 are family households, 3,116 are non-family households, 1,448 are households with children and 4,588 are households without children. The average number of people per household in Butler is 2.15.

Income/Financial

  • Average Household Income$51,772
  • Median Household Income$36,570
  • Median Income Under 25$28,606
  • Median Income 25-44$39,982
  • Median Income 45-64$34,278
  • Median Income Over 65$32,853

The average household income for people living in Butler is $51,772, while the median household income is $36,570. The median income in Butler is $28,606 for those under 25, $39,982 for those aged 25 to 44, $34,278 for those aged 45 to 64, and $32,853 for those over the age of 65.
